当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

mysql8数据库迁移到新服务器,深入解析MySQL 8数据库迁移至新服务器的步骤与技巧

mysql8数据库迁移到新服务器,深入解析MySQL 8数据库迁移至新服务器的步骤与技巧

MySQL 8数据库迁移至新服务器涉及详细步骤与技巧。备份旧数据库,创建新服务器环境,安装MySQL 8,配置新服务器。导出旧数据库数据,导入新服务器,调整连接参数,测...

MySQL 8数据库迁移至新服务器涉及详细步骤与技巧。备份旧数据库,创建新服务器环境,安装MySQL 8,配置新服务器。导出旧数据库数据,导入新服务器,调整连接参数,测试新数据库。优化性能,处理潜在问题,确保数据完整性和迁移成功。

随着互联网的快速发展,企业对数据库的依赖性日益增强,数据库迁移是企业日常运维中的一项重要工作,而MySQL作为一款优秀的开源数据库,其迁移工作尤为重要,本文将详细介绍MySQL 8数据库迁移至新服务器的步骤与技巧,帮助您顺利完成数据库迁移。

准备工作

1、确保源数据库与目标数据库版本一致,避免兼容性问题。

mysql8数据库迁移到新服务器,深入解析MySQL 8数据库迁移至新服务器的步骤与技巧

2、备份源数据库,以防迁移过程中出现意外。

3、确定迁移方式,包括全量迁移、增量迁移和在线迁移等。

4、确定迁移过程中的安全措施,如加密传输、访问控制等。

5、准备迁移工具,如mysqldump、phpMyAdmin等。

迁移步骤

1、全量迁移

(1)使用mysqldump命令备份源数据库:

mysqldump -u 用户名 -p 数据库名 > 数据库名.sql

(2)将备份文件传输至目标服务器。

(3)在目标服务器上创建数据库和用户:

mysql8数据库迁移到新服务器,深入解析MySQL 8数据库迁移至新服务器的步骤与技巧

CREATE DATABASE 数据库名;
CREATE USER '用户名'@'localhost' IDENTIFIED BY '密码';
GRANT ALL PRIVILEGES ON 数据库名.* TO '用户名'@'localhost';
FLUSH PRIVILEGES;

(4)使用mysql命令导入备份文件:

mysql -u 用户名 -p 数据库名 < 数据库名.sql

2、增量迁移

(1)备份源数据库的binlog文件。

(2)在目标服务器上配置binlog文件。

(3)使用mysqlbinlog工具解析binlog文件,生成SQL语句。

(4)在目标服务器上执行生成的SQL语句,实现增量迁移。

3、在线迁移

(1)使用phpMyAdmin等在线迁移工具,配置源数据库和目标数据库。

mysql8数据库迁移到新服务器,深入解析MySQL 8数据库迁移至新服务器的步骤与技巧

(2)根据提示进行在线迁移操作。

注意事项

1、在迁移过程中,确保网络稳定,避免数据丢失。

2、迁移过程中,关注迁移进度,及时处理异常情况。

3、迁移完成后,对目标数据库进行性能优化。

4、验证迁移后的数据库,确保数据完整性和一致性。

黑狐家游戏

发表评论

最新文章